Abstract
The invention relates to a process for pulling a pipe (2)laid and/or to be laid in the ground to a trench below andaccessible from ground level, in which there is a traction systemin engagement with a traction component (3). The tractioncomponent (3) is taken through the pipe and engaged with its rearend, viewed in the pulling direction. The traction component (3)with the pipe is then drawn to the trench in steps by the tractionsystem, with the traction device making a forward and a backwardstroke at each step. During the backward stroke the tractioncomponent (3) is kept under a tension corresponding to its elasticexpansion during the forward stroke. In this way the tractioncomponent (3) is kept permanently under tension throughout thepulling process, thus preventing the traction component fromalternately expanding and contracting at each step. In a preferreddevice for implementing this process, the traction component hascatches (4) with a predetermined spacing and the traction systemhas a pulling member (12) which engages with one of the catchesduring the forward stroke and a retainer (l7) which is engagedwith one of the catches during the backward stroke.39 claims, 8 figures
